About the Book

Reform cookery book 4th edition presents a structured guide to preparing nutritious vegetarian meals with an emphasis on balance, digestion, and everyday practicality. The work promotes a food philosophy centered on natural ingredients, careful preparation, and mindful eating habits rather than indulgence or excess. It explains how thoughtful cooking methods can improve well being and household economy while still delivering variety and flavor. Alongside recipes, the text offers guidance on menu planning, ingredient selection, and kitchen organization, encouraging readers to treat cooking as both a discipline and a form of care. Many dishes are designed to replace heavier fare with lighter combinations built from grains, vegetables, dairy, and plant proteins. Instructional notes highlight efficiency, cleanliness, and measured use of spices and fats. The overall approach blends instruction with advocacy, presenting meat free cookery as a sustainable lifestyle choice tied to health, ethics, and domestic skill. The book frames the kitchen as a place of reform where better choices lead to stronger bodies and more orderly living, giving readers a complete system rather than just a recipe list.
